当前位置:首页 » 文件管理 » javaapplet上传文件

javaapplet上传文件

发布时间: 2022-10-01 14:06:16

① 要用java实现多线程的文件上传该如何去做

的资源消耗,因此,在进行同类事情,需要进行互相的通讯等等事情的时候,都采用线程来进行处理。

对于只做固定的一件事情(比如:计算1+2+3+...+9999999)来说,其性能上不会比采用单线程的整体效率高,原因是,同时都是要做这么多运算,采用多线程的话,系统在进行线程调度的过程中喙浪费一些资源和时间,从而性能上下降。

那么,多线程是否就没有存在的意义了呢?答案当然不是的。多线程还是有存在的价值的,我们在写输入流输出流,写网络程序等等的时候,都会出现阻塞的情况,如果说,我们不使用多线程的话,从A中读数据出来的时候,A因为没有准备好,而整个程序阻塞了,其他的任何事情都没法进行。如果采用多线程的话,你就不用担心这个问题了。还举个例子:游戏中,如果A角色和B角色采用同一个线程来处理的话,那么,很有可能就会出现只会响应A角色的操作,而B角色就始终被占用了的情况,这样,玩起来肯定就没劲了。

因此,线程是有用的,但也不是随便乱用,乱用的话,可能造成性能的低下,它是有一点的适用范围的,一般我认为:需要响应多个人的事情,从设计上需要考虑同时做一些事情(这些事情很多情况下可能一点关系都没有,也有可能有一些关系的)。

使用多线程的时候,如果某些线程之间涉及到资源共享、互相通讯等等问题的时候,一定得注意线程安全的问题,根据情况看是不是需要使用synchronized关键字。
另外,站长团上有产品团购,便宜有保证

② java applet文件要怎么样做运行,在那里写程序呢尽量详细些!!!

<applet code="Einstein.class" width=600 height=400>
</applet>

将这段代码用文字编辑软件写字板或者UltraEdit保存为.html文件,把Einstein.class替换成你边写的java小程序生成的class文件名,用你的浏览器就可以打开刚存的.html文件就可以看效果了。因为applet小程序主要是用来在网络之间传输信息的

③ JAVA WEB怎么实现大文件上传

解决这种大文件上传不太可能用web上传的方式,只有自己开发插件或是当门客户端上传,或者用现有的ftp等。
1)开发一个web插件。用于上传文件。
2)开发一个FTP工具,不用web上传。
3)用现有的FTP工具。
下面是几款不错的插件,你可以试试:
1)Jquery的uploadify插件。具体使用。你可以看帮助文档。
2)网上有一个Web大文件断点续传控件:http://www.cnblogs.com/xproer/archive/2012/02/17/2355440.html
此控件支持100G文件的断点续传操作,提供了完善的开发文档,支持文件MD5验证,支持文件批量上传。
JavaUploader免费开源的,是用applet实现的,需要签名才能在浏览器上用,支持断点。缺点是收费。
3)applet也是一种方式,MUPLOAD组件就是以APPLET方式处理的。
如果你不需要访问用户的硬盘文件,那你可以使用FTP上传,也支持断点。但只要你访问用户磁盘,又要支持断点,那必须要签名的。不然浏览器不知道你的身份。

④ java applet中jar包替换后不生效,咋办

这个有可能是你的服务器上的代码编译的Java版本和你本地的eclipse所用的Java版本不一致造成的。
你看一下服务器上的项目的Java是什么版本的。再看一下你自己的版本是什么样的 。

⑤ Java Applet可以往服务器上写文件吗

方法一:makeSecondlyTrigger
注意以下代码将创建一个立即启动的触发器。要控制启动时间,使用
trigger.setStartTime方法。
/
Triggertrigger=TriggerUtils.makeSecondlyTrigger;
trigger.setName;
trigger.setGroup;
/

方法二:设置SimpleTrigger的重复次数和间隔时间。
注意以下代码将创建一个立即启动的触发器。要控制启动时间,使用
trigger.setStartTime方法。
/
Triggertrigger=newSimpleTrigger;
trigger.setRepeatCount;
trigger.setRepeatInterval;//milliseconds

按间隔时间运行任务Triggertrigger=newSimpleTrigger;
//24hours60
//601000
//24小时60(分钟每小时)60(秒每分钟)1000(毫秒每秒钟)
trigger.setRepeatInterval;

⑥ 如何在HTML中加入Java Applet

1、建立applet文件。比如文件命名为newapplet.java ,该文件内的class也命名为newapplet。

2、进入dos。具体做法:(假设newapplet.java存放在E盘的applet\src中) 开始->运行->cmd-> e:->cd applet\src->javac newapplet.java

3、经过步骤2,可以发现在E:\applet\src中新生成了newapplet.class文件。利用记事本在E:\applet\src中建立1.html文件。
其中1.html文件中的代码为:
<applet code=newapplet.class height=300 width=300>
</applet>

4、使用浏览器运行1.html文件。之前自己编辑的newapplet文件已经嵌入其中了。

⑦ 如何插入java Applet

1.<object>标签
<object classid = 'clsid:CAFEEFAC-0016-0000-0011-ABCDEFFEDCBA'
codebase ='jre/jre-6u-windows-i586-s.exe' WIDTH = '100%'
HEIGHT = '100%' MAYSCRIPT=true
NAME = 'NAME' id='ID'>
<PARAM NAME = java_arguments VALUE = '-Dsun.java2d.d3d=false -Xmx512m'>
<PARAM NAME = CODE VALUE = 'XXX.class'>
<PARAM NAME = CODEBASE VALUE = 'applet'>
<PARAM NAME = 'type' VALUE = 'application/x-java-applet;jpi-version=1.6.0'>

</object>
在 classid属性中"xxxx", "yyyy", 以及 "zzzz" 是4个数字,用来指出要使用的 Java 插件的版本。比如,如果使用 Java 插件 1.5.0,可以这样定义: classid="clsid:CAFEEFAC-0015-0000-0000-ABCDEFFEDCBA"
code value 是 applet那个类的路径 这里是相对的也可以写绝对的,
code base 里面的路径是服务器段jre安装文件的路径,如果客户端没有装jre会自动从这个地址下载,可以是绝对的或者相对的路径
2.<applet标签>
3.<embed>
后面两种标签我没有写,楼主可以自己查查,要说明的是object标签这样写不能在火狐里面运行

⑧ java applet怎么传递数据

int ident=0;//控制空格数量的变量
while (weekday!=firstDayOfWeek) {
ident++;
d.add(Calendar.DAY_OF_MONTH, -1);
weekday=d.get(Calendar.DAY_OF_WEEK);
}

⑨ 如何用Java客户端/applet通过HTTP POST上传文件

java.net.HttpURLConnection 来Post

想方便,就使用apache的HttpClient

⑩ 有人知道html 怎么放Java的applet么

1、建立applet文件。比如文件命名为newapplet.java ,该文件内的class也命名为newapplet。
2、进入dos。具体做法:(假设newapplet.java存放在E盘的applet\src中) 开始->运行->cmd-> e:->cd applet\src->javac newapplet.java
3、经过步骤2,可以发现在E:\applet\src中新生成了newapplet.class文件。利用记事本在E:\applet\src中建立1.html文件。
其中1.html文件中的代码为:
<applet code=newapplet.class height=300 width=300>
</applet>
4、使用浏览器运行1.html文件。之前自己编辑的newapplet文件已经嵌入其中了。

热点内容
sql判断今天 发布:2024-10-09 04:19:35 浏览:942
拆分视频需要哪些配置 发布:2024-10-09 04:06:39 浏览:911
安装电脑网络需要哪些配置 发布:2024-10-09 03:57:28 浏览:962
风云城服务器ip地址 发布:2024-10-09 03:53:18 浏览:634
c算法 发布:2024-10-09 03:53:10 浏览:119
androidstudio大小写忽略 发布:2024-10-09 03:53:10 浏览:569
苹果8p音效和安卓的音效哪个好 发布:2024-10-09 03:45:59 浏览:591
c语言动态分配空间 发布:2024-10-09 03:35:14 浏览:983
死歌脚本 发布:2024-10-09 03:11:55 浏览:86
企业内网搭建电影服务器侵权吗 发布:2024-10-09 03:07:14 浏览:107